RangeGaspBehaviorFlags

Inheritance: java.lang.Object, java.lang.Enum

public enum RangeGaspBehaviorFlags extends Enum<RangeGaspBehaviorFlags>

Flags describing desired rasterizer behavior.

Fields

FieldDescription
GASP_DOGRAYUse grayscale rendering (0x0002).
GASP_GRIDFITUse gridfitting (0x0001).
GASP_SYMMETRIC_GRIDFITUse gridfitting with ClearType symmetric smoothing (0x0004).
GASP_SYMMETRIC_SMOOTHINGUse smoothing along multiple axes with ClearType (0x0008).
ReservedReserved flags - set to 0 (0xfff0).
neitherOptional for very large sizes, typically ppem > 2048 (0x0000).

Methods

MethodDescription
valueOf(Class arg0, String arg1)
compareTo(E arg0)
describeConstable()
equals(Object arg0)
getClass()
getDeclaringClass()
getFlags(int value)Returns a set of flags corresponding to an integer value.
hashCode()
name()
notify()
notifyAll()
ordinal()
toInteger(AsFoEnumSet flags)Returns the integer value corresponding to a set of flags.
toString()
valueOf(String name)
values()
wait()
wait(long arg0)
wait(long arg0, int arg1)

GASP_DOGRAY

public static final RangeGaspBehaviorFlags GASP_DOGRAY

Use grayscale rendering (0x0002).

GASP_GRIDFIT

public static final RangeGaspBehaviorFlags GASP_GRIDFIT

Use gridfitting (0x0001).

GASP_SYMMETRIC_GRIDFIT

public static final RangeGaspBehaviorFlags GASP_SYMMETRIC_GRIDFIT

Use gridfitting with ClearType symmetric smoothing (0x0004). Only supported in version 1 ‘gasp’.

GASP_SYMMETRIC_SMOOTHING

public static final RangeGaspBehaviorFlags GASP_SYMMETRIC_SMOOTHING

Use smoothing along multiple axes with ClearType (0x0008). Only supported in version 1 ‘gasp’.

Reserved

public static final RangeGaspBehaviorFlags Reserved

Reserved flags - set to 0 (0xfff0).

neither

public static final RangeGaspBehaviorFlags neither

Optional for very large sizes, typically ppem > 2048 (0x0000).

valueOf(Class arg0, String arg1)

public static T <T>valueOf(Class<T> arg0, String arg1)

Parameters:

ParameterTypeDescription
arg0java.lang.Class
arg1java.lang.String

Returns: T

compareTo(E arg0)

public final int compareTo(E arg0)

Parameters:

ParameterTypeDescription
arg0E

Returns: int

describeConstable()

public final Optional<Enum.EnumDesc<E>> describeConstable()

Returns: java.util.Optional<java.lang.Enum.EnumDesc>

equals(Object arg0)

public final boolean equals(Object arg0)

Parameters:

ParameterTypeDescription
arg0java.lang.Object

Returns: boolean

getClass()

public final native Class<?> getClass()

Returns: java.lang.Class

getDeclaringClass()

public final Class<E> getDeclaringClass()

Returns: java.lang.Class

getFlags(int value)

public static AsFoEnumSet<RangeGaspBehaviorFlags> getFlags(int value)

Returns a set of flags corresponding to an integer value.

Parameters:

ParameterTypeDescription
valueintThe integer value.

Returns: AsFoEnumSet - The set of flags corresponding to the integer value.

hashCode()

public final int hashCode()

Returns: int

name()

public final String name()

Returns: java.lang.String

notify()

public final native void notify()

notifyAll()

public final native void notifyAll()

ordinal()

public final int ordinal()

Returns: int

toInteger(AsFoEnumSet flags)

public static int toInteger(AsFoEnumSet<RangeGaspBehaviorFlags> flags)

Returns the integer value corresponding to a set of flags.

Parameters:

ParameterTypeDescription
flagscom.aspose.font.util.AsFoEnumSet<com.aspose.font.RangeGaspBehaviorFlags>A set of flags.

Returns: int - The integer value corresponding to a set of flags.

toString()

public String toString()

Returns: java.lang.String

valueOf(String name)

public static RangeGaspBehaviorFlags valueOf(String name)

Parameters:

ParameterTypeDescription
namejava.lang.String

Returns: RangeGaspBehaviorFlags

values()

public static RangeGaspBehaviorFlags[] values()

Returns: com.aspose.font.RangeGaspBehaviorFlags[]

wait()

public final void wait()

wait(long arg0)

public final native void wait(long arg0)

Parameters:

ParameterTypeDescription
arg0long

wait(long arg0, int arg1)

public final void wait(long arg0, int arg1)

Parameters:

ParameterTypeDescription
arg0long
arg1int